Transaction e63c80acb3339d69d7137f747edcc32cbf703ec269ae26ffb62f5c1a3a477687
1 Input
2 Outputs
- e63c80acb3339d69d7137f747edcc32cbf703ec269ae26ffb62f5c1a3a477687:0
- e63c80acb3339d69d7137f747edcc32cbf703ec269ae26ffb62f5c1a3a477687:1
value 247660
address 16BHKyTbQHHJ6LS7roXDEQUh82doL5e3vN
value 454081
address 18DyJC71ZkCZ2VfP7igreskNVUcDAadh1P